Transaction 64b7d44289e5ac6e6ffe115db42f4297308845ded806a58cdbc51a805ac517c5
1 Input
2 Outputs
- 64b7d44289e5ac6e6ffe115db42f4297308845ded806a58cdbc51a805ac517c5:0
- 64b7d44289e5ac6e6ffe115db42f4297308845ded806a58cdbc51a805ac517c5:1
value 1240000
address 32dXPcRRQLQN26RiYykVcquQwDeQjsRXCT
value 321072
address 3PjNUL2E9f8eMPn3D1iBC7cFnJmqBVjr81